Drooping mouth corners are a common ageing change that can significantly affect self-confidence, making you look sad, cross or tired even when this isn’t the case.

What are drooping mouth corners?

In a youthful face, the corners of the mouth are typically neutral or slightly elevated, creating an aesthetically pleasing expression. Drooping mouth corners have very negative connotations.

What causes drooping mouth corners?

Drooping mouth corners are caused by the muscles in the jaw that pull downwards becoming stronger over time. The loss of collagen and elastin compounds this as we get older. These naturally occurring proteins in the skin provide strength, support and elasticity and, as they deplete, the tissues of the face descend.

The repetitive action of frowning can lead to drooping mouth corners and deep folds to appear between the mouth and jaw. These are called marionette lines, and which can drag the corners of the mouth downwards.

Do drooping mouth corners worsen with age?

Genetics play a role, and some men and women have a more pronounced downward turn of the mouth from an early age, but this is an aesthetic concern that typically worsens with age.

The loss of volume in the mid-face and lateral sides of the face can also cause these lines to appear on the sides of the mouth and the edge of the mouth to turn downwards. Other causes include sun damage, stress and smoking.

What are the best treatments for drooping mouth corners?

Muscle relaxing injections are an effective non-surgical treatment for drooping mouth corners. It works by temporarily blocking the signal from our nerves to our muscles. When injected into the depressor anguli oris muscle that pulls down the corner of the mouth, it can elevate the edges of the mouth.

Temporary hyaluronic acid dermal fillers replace plumpness in the face and can fill folds such as the marionette lines or provide structural support in the jawline and around the mouth. Dermal fillers can also be used to restore mid-face volume, which can help to lift the lower face.

The drooping corners of the mouth, the loss of definition of the jawline, the formation of jowls and the marionette lines can all be addressed with a SMAS facelift. For optimal results or to prolong the longevity of the lower facelift, you may wish to combine it with dermal fillers or muscle relaxing injections.

A facelift (rhytidectomy) is a surgical procedure that can improve the most visible signs of the ageing process by eliminating excess fat, tightening and elevating the muscles beneath the skin of the face and by removing or repositioning sagging skin.

Deep plane facelift surgery is the skillful uncovering of the anatomical plane under the muscles known as the Superficial Musculo-Aponeurotic System, SMAS (the fibrous tissue and the skin’s plasma). The facelift lifts this, all in one, upwards. As your surgeon will be working underneath your muscles, your skin remains looking natural, never stretched or tight.
